Citroën DSuper 20 | 1971

Highlights:

  • 1985 cc 4-cylinder petrol engine
  • Manual transmission
  • Valid technical inspection report available
  • Hydraulic system in good condition
  • Optically beautiful and technically solid

The seller offers this Citroën DSuper 20, registered on June 1, 1972. Date of declaration of conformity: January 1, 1975. One owner (the second transfer took place only for inheritance purposes in 2024). Equipped with a 5-speed manual transmission, optional on this 2.0 version. Well maintained, restored and beautiful bodywork, strong underbody, well preserved interior, mechanics and hydraulics recently overhauled and in good working order. A must for lovers of the Double Chevron brand, perfect for lovers of the model and sure to impress as a wedding rental car.

Only a few traces of rust under the rear license plate, in the luggage compartment and in the pedal area, and a few scratches in the chrome on the bumpers.

The Citroen DS, introduced in the mid-1950s, quickly became one of the most revolutionary cars of its era. Known for its futuristic design by Flaminio Bertoni and advanced technology, it set new standards in comfort and innovation. Its hydropneumatic suspension provided an unparalleled ride, while the aerodynamic body design made it stand out from its contemporaries. By 1971, the DS had firmly established itself as both a symbol of French elegance and a forward-thinking engineering marvel. This particular example, with its low mileage and classic sedan body, represents the timeless appeal of the DS and remains an icon in automotive history.
